Transaction 724eb542a08a8b81f257f95346ea093af3453e8fa5da7e4ec2115fefcee577ba

26 Input
2 Outputs
  • 724eb542a08a8b81f257f95346ea093af3453e8fa5da7e4ec2115fefcee577ba:0
  • value  615924519
    address  12uFJzF9HKXqdViBwQHLFGXf4KGz4z42rP
  • 724eb542a08a8b81f257f95346ea093af3453e8fa5da7e4ec2115fefcee577ba:1
  • value  1000131
    address  1LB3hirLBYw4Ria71PTAQXzR79Aya4ntDz